Job Description

We are seeking a highly experienced Senior Process Improvement Consultant to lead enterprise-wide process optimization and transformation initiatives. This role will focus on evaluating current-state business processes, designing optimized future-state solutions, and translating improved workflows into functional and non-functional requirements for modular or low-code technology platforms.

The ideal candidate will bring strong Lean and Six Sigma expertise, stakeholder engagement skills, and experience leading transformation initiatives within large organizations.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ct end-to-end reviews of business processes across designated departments or functional areas.

  • Engage stakeholders to identify process pain points, bottlenecks, and improvement opportunities.

  • Document “As-Is” workflows and analyze them using Lean and Six Sigma methodologies.

  • Design optimized “To-Be” workflows and transition strategies.

  • Translate optimized processes into functional and non-functional specifications for modular or low-code solutions.

  • Collaborate with product and IT teams to ensure process requirements align with system architecture and tool design.

  • Provide data-driven recommendations to enhance efficiency, reduce waste, and improve operational performance.

  • Establish KPIs and metrics to measure improvements and return on investment (ROI).

  • Facilitate process mapping workshops, working sessions, and training initiatives.

  • Support development of implementation roadmaps and change management strategies.

  • Align process improvement initiatives with organizational goals and system capabilities.


Minimum Qualifications:

  • 8+ years of experience in process engineering, operations optimization, or business process improvement.

  • 5+ years of experience evaluating and optimizing current-state processes.

  • Experience specifying software system requirements to support improved business solutions.

  • Six Sigma Black Belt certification (required).

  • Proven track record leading large-scale process transformation initiatives.

  • Proficiency with process modeling tools (e.g., Visio or similar).

  • Strong facilitation, communication, and stakeholder management skills.

  • Experience with operational metrics, workflow optimization, and cross-functional collaboration.
